2013 Toyota bB clutch-kit — is it used on this model?
For the 2013 Toyota bB (QNC20/21/25 series), a traditional manual clutch-kit isn’t relevant. Technical references show this model was built with an automatic transmission only, so there’s no manual clutch assembly to service or replace. Sources that back this up include the Toyota Electronic Parts Catalog (EPC) for QNC20/21/25, the Japanese-market Toyota bB Owner’s Manual (2012–2015 printings) listing a 4‑speed automatic (Super ECT), and Toyota service/repair literature that covers automatic transaxle servicing without any manual clutch section for this generation.
Because it’s an auto, the bB uses a torque converter and internal multi-plate clutch packs inside the transmission, not a single friction clutch and pressure plate. Those internal clutches aren’t replaced as a “clutch kit”
